The night sky witnesses different shades of the Moon from time to time. This may not be the first time people are watching a different color of the Moon. There was Blue Moon, Strawberry moon and even Red Wolf Moon in the night sky. And this time North America will witness a Black Moon on July 31.
The next new moon (8 Leo 36) falls on August 1, 2019, at 03:12 UTC; that is, July 31 at 23:12 p.m. EDT. For some parts of the world, this will be the second new moon of July- aka, a Black Moon. It’s also a supermoon. See the young crescent moon after sunset in early August.

According to the reports, this is the first Black Moon to occur since 2016. And in every 32 months, we can watch two of both full and new Moon. The approximate time for the occurrence is 11.13pm EDT.
